Management of Serious discomfort continues to characterize a region of good unmet biomedical have to have. Though opioid analgesics are typically embraced given that the mainstay of pharmaceutical interventions Within this place, they are afflicted by sizeable liabilities which include habit and tolerance, as well as despair of breathing, nausea and chronic constipation. Due to their suboptimal therapeutic profile, the seek for non-opioid analgesics to replace these well-established therapeutics is a vital pursuit. Conolidine is actually a exceptional C5-nor stemmadenine normal product just lately isolated from your stem bark of Tabernaemontana divaricata (a tropical flowering plant Employed in conventional Chinese, Ayurvedic and Thai medicine).
